Transaction c1fc77327091e544f61f04871d4dbabf5219b939ccd8a87869a93b823d53f7dd
1 Input
1 Output
-
c1fc77327091e544f61f04871d4dbabf5219b939ccd8a87869a93b823d53f7dd:0
- value
- 2939585
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9e620ac2057ee639af75e92e7398786c425188b7 OP_EQUAL
- address
- 3G8U8w1zB6Y5mW2HFic7f5VHvvkTPU6x1T